MARCO - the Museo de Arte Contemporaneo de Monterrey - opened in 1991 and remains one of the finest museum buildings in Mexico. Ricardo Legorreta designed it in his signature language: massive planes of colour, deep-set openings, water and light used as materials, all organized around a central patio where a shallow pool periodically erupts in a sheet of falling water. At the entrance stands the museum's mascot, Juan Soriano's enormous bronze dove - Paloma - which every visitor photographs and every child tries to climb. Inside, the programme is exhibition-driven rather than collection-driven: large temporary shows of Mexican and international contemporary art occupy the main galleries in rotation, with the museum's own holdings surfacing in curated selections. The scale of the rooms allows ambitious installation, and the building's circulation - ramps, sightlines through openings, the courtyard always reappearing - is a pleasure in itself. The cafe and shop are good, and the Macroplaza's monuments and cathedral stand immediately outside.

When to go
Any day but Monday; check what is showing, since the museum turns over entirely between exhibitions. Free-entry days draw crowds.
Honest expectations
There is no permanent display to fall back on - a weak exhibition means a short visit, though the building repays it. Labels are Spanish-first. The surrounding Macroplaza is hot and shadeless at midday.
Nearby
The Macroplaza, the cathedral and the Paseo Santa Lucia canal to Fundidora all begin at the door.
